SL295/SS508 Review of Current Sugarcane Fertilizer Recommendations: A Report from the UF/IFAS Sugarcane Fertilizer Standards Task Force

SL-295, a 6-page report by K.T. Morgan, J.M. McCray, R.W. Rice, R.A. Gilbert and L.E. Baucum, reports the findings of a task force of Florida agronomists and soil scientists, agents and local grower representatives. It includes a review of the current fertilizer recommendations for sugarcane, a review of recent sugarcane fertilizer research, and an assessment of the gaps and recommended research priorities. Published by the UF Department of Soil and Water Science, July 2009.

SL288/SS501 Greenhouse Gas Emissions in the Everglades: The Role of Hydrologic Conditions

SL288, a 5-page illustrated fact sheet by Alan L. Wright and K.R. Reddy, describes the relationship between global warming and increases in greenhouse gas emissions, the role of Everglades wetlands in the global carbon cycle and their contribution to greenhouse gas production, and how hydrologic conditions and eutrophication in the Everglades influence the rates and types of greenhouse gases emitted. Includes references. Published by the UF Department of Soil and Water Science, May 2009.

SL287/SS500 Soil pH Effects on Nutrient Availability in the Everglades Agricultural Area

SL287, a 5-page fact sheet by Alan L. Wright, Edward A. Hanlon, David Sui, and Ronald Rice, identifies strategies that could be used to address the problem of the increasing pH in muck soils. Includes references. Published by the UF Department of Soil and Water Science, May 2009.
